I took my younger brother deer hunting yesterday, his first time
hunting anything. We were in an elevated blind where I had killed a buck two days earlier with my Henry Bison Tribute 45-70. My brother was using a Henry BB 44 magnum. We had been out about 75 minutes and things were looking bleak when all of a sudden a big buck (7 points) walked up. He didn’t go to the corn but just walked off to the side and stood there. My brother readjusted his shooting position and the buck picked us up since the sun had come up and was lighting us up a little. The buck started to trot away. I could tell my brother thought he wasn’t going to get a shot so I yelled “aim a little high and shoot”. One shot and the buck dropped in his tracks. My rangefinder read 126 yards. My brother is now hooked on deer hunting and hooked on Henry rifles.
